Common Elements Used in Contracts for Government Contracting
Field or Control |
Description |
---|---|
Account |
ChartField that identifies the nature of a transaction for corporate accounts. |
Accounting Date |
Date for accounting entries for an activity. |
Activity ID |
PeopleSoft Project Costing activity identifier assigned to a task within a project. |
Bill To Customer |
Customer receiving the invoice. |
Billing Business Unit |
PeopleSoft Billing business unit representing a grouping of customer invoices. |
Business Unit |
Identification code that represents a high-level organization of business information. Use a business unit to define regional or departmental units within a larger organization. |
Budget Reference |
ChartField that identifies unique control budgets when individual budgets share budget keys and overlapping budget periods. |
Class Field |
ChartField that identifies a particular appropriation when you combine it with a Fund, DeptID (department ID), Program Code, and Budget Reference ChartField. This field is not applicable to government contracts. |
Contract or Contract Number |
Displays the unique identifier for a contract that can be assigned by the system or the user. |
Contract Type |
Enables you to categorize your contracts for reporting purposes. |
Currency |
Code that identifies the currency for an amount, such as USD or EUR. |
Fund Code |
ChartField that represents structural units for education and government accounting. Can also represent a divisional breakdown in your organization. |
Fund Affiliate |
ChartField that is used to correlate transactions between funds when using a single intraunit account. |
Line |
Displays the contract line number associated with the product after it has been added to the contact. |
Operating Unit Affiliate |
ChartField that is used to correlate transactions between operating units when using a single intraunit account. |
Process Monitor |
Click this link to view the status of submitted process requests. |
Program Code |
ChartField that identifies groups of related activities, cost centers, revenue centers, responsibility centers, and academic programs. Tracks revenue and expenditures for programs. |
Report Manager |
Click this link to view report content, check the status of a report, and view content detail messages. |
Run |
Click this button to specify the location where a process or job runs and the process output format. |
Run Control ID |
Identification code that identifies the run parameters for a report or process. |
SetID |
Identification code that represents a set of control table information or tablesets. A tableset is a group of tables (records) necessary to define your company's structure and processing options. |
Sold To or Sold To Customer |
Customer buying the products and services specified on the contract. |
